For those that are history buffs, too, also.
The attached PDF is a December 27, 1900 article in The Mining Reporter (Vol. 42, No. 26) entitled, "A Busy Valley". There are two photos, one is "The Gorge of Clear Creek, Colo., Through the Front Range" and the other is "Black Hawk, Colorado, Looking up Gregory Gulch". [attachment=11020:Clear_Cr...Reporter.pdf] |

Did a little prospecting for a new winter location. The new Big Easy Trailhead looks promising! Plenty of sun, paved trail right to the creek (makes hauling gear to the creek a breeze!), a bathroom, lots of cobble to work, and I got decent gold from 6 buckets. A quick video of the spot I made: https://www.facebook.com/bobbittm/videos/10...771122016993958 Here's the spot I tested First test bucket Second bucket; hit a nice chunky layer! Buckets 3-6. Got out of the chunky layer and in to the CCC fines! With the new trail bringing more folks Creekside, we've really got to be cognizant of our digging activities and ensure we're filling in our holes! There are a few sections of the Canyon that look like war zones, with tailings piles and 6' deep holes everywhere. Sure way for Jefferson County to consider excluding prospecting from the allowed activities in the park! So let's all PLEASE do our part to be positive representatives of the club and prospectors as a whole!
